How to make Blackstone Veggie Hummus Wraps
First slice your veggies and put them on a tray to carry out to the griddle or flat top grill.
I have some mushrooms, a red bell pepper, and half of a red onion.
Also minced garlic and chopped, fresh spinach.

Preheat your Blackstone or any brand griddle to medium heat for a few minutes.
Then add some cooking oil of choice along with the mushrooms, peppers, and onions.
Cook for 3 to 4 minutes, mixing it all together with hibachi spatulas.

Then add the spinach, garlic, kosher salt, pepper, crushed red pepper flakes, and oregano.
And cook another 3 to 4 minutes.
Finally, mix in either balsamic vinegar or lemon juice and cook another minute.
Then remove the veggie mix to make the wraps.

I scraped my griddle and lowered the heat while I made the wraps.

Lay each large tortilla flat and spread some hummus, pile on LOTS of veggies, and top with feta.
Then roll them up like burritos.

Add a little more oil to the griddle and place them seam side down.
They will take a minute or two per side, really depending on how crisp you want them.

Blackstone Veggie Hummus Wraps
Equipment
- Blackstone Griddle
- Flat Top Grill/ Griddle
Ingredients
- cooking oil of choice
- 8 ounces mushrooms sliced
- 1 red bell pepper sliced
- 1 red onion sliced
- 6 ounces spinach leaves chopped
- 4 to 6 cloves garlic minced
- kosher salt, pepper, crushed red pepper flakes, dried oregano (to taste)
- 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ar or lemon juice
- 2 extra large flour tortillas (I used Extreme Wellness Low Carb Tortillas)
- 1/2 cup hummus
- 1/2 cup feta cheese crumbles
Instructions
- Preheat the griddle to medium heat for a few minutes. Add some cooking oil and the mushrooms, peppers, and onions. Cook 3 to 4 minutes, mixing together with hibachi spatulas.
- Add the spinach, garlic, kosher salt, pepper, crushed red pepper flakes, and oregano. Cook another 3 to 4 minutes. Mix in the balsamic vinegar or lemon juice and cook another minute on the griddle.
- Scrape the griddle and turn the heat to low. Assemble the wraps with some hummus, veggies, and feta cheese in the center, roll them up like a burrito.
- Add a little more cooking oil to the griddle and place the wraps, seam side down. Cook 1 to 2 minutes per side or until crisped how you prefer.
